## Dependency Pinning Policy

Marrowgate pins all direct dependencies to exact versions; transitive deps are locked at build time. Support team: if a customer reports a version mismatch, check their lockfile age against the pin refresh cadence before escalating. Pins are refreshed on a fixed schedule, with a grace window for security patches. The cadence and window values are defined below.

constants for tageg-kagag:
QUOTAS = {
    "kelax": 495,
    "istath": 366,
    "tammir": 108,
    "novdor": 730,
    "casax": 816,
    "quenael": 874,
    "pelius": 403,
}

Ticket: Timing-chip reader at Oakmere Marathon checkpoint 4 reporting zero reads.

Root cause: staging env vars deployed to the field unit. READER_POLL_MS was 5000, should be 200. Fix pushed; verify before Sunday's race. The reader also needs its uplink credential restored — it belongs on the line directly below.

secret setting of baduf-fahag: LEDGER_TOKEN8=35e35511

## Local Setup

The Givenly receipt mailer generates PDF donation receipts and queues them for delivery. Clone the repo, install dependencies with `make deps`, then run `make seed` to load sample donors. The mailer reads donor and donation data directly from the dev database, so before starting the worker, export the connection string shown below.

primary connection of yagep-kahip = redis://giliel_svc:zYiKsLL2PLpfPL@db-348f.xolmarsys.corp:5432/fenwyn

Branch managers should be aware that Aldercrest Group has agreed in principle to sell its Fenwick Instruments unit to a private investor consortium. Due diligence is underway and expected to conclude within ten weeks. Branch operations continue unchanged during this period; customer commitments, staffing, and service levels remain the responsibility of current management. Any inbound inquiries should be routed to the transition office without comment. The confidential strategic context appears below.

management briefing: Project Ulavan slips by two quarters because of the staffing delay.